Over a century of nurturing the next generation
Once a convent, now non-denominational with a Christian ethos, the school has been educating pupils since 1920. The school has maintained throughout its long history the passion and desire to stimulate, inspire and challenge every child at every stage of their development.

Serving the Wolverhampton and the West Midlands
Welcoming both girls and boys from 4-19 we operate two dedicated bus services serving the Wolverhampton area which picks up pupils for the junior school, senior school and the sixth form. The services have pickups across Wolverhampton including Finchfield, Tettenhall, Perton, Compton, Penn and also includes bus route transfers serving Telford, Bridgnorth, Stafford and Newport.
Our approach to school fees
As a not-for-profit company, we invest all profits back into school. As a result, we have the lowest fees of any local independent schools without compromising on the quality of education, facilities or class sizes. Class sizes are maximum 18 in the preparatory school. This continues for most subjects in the senior school where small classes allow for more personalised learning especially the core subjects of maths, English and science.
